Transaction 901861a08a5887dd67e3bbe47855646f515d2d17261a91299c9d088c2097289f
1 Input
1 Output
-
901861a08a5887dd67e3bbe47855646f515d2d17261a91299c9d088c2097289f:0
- value
- 2962704
- script pubkey
- OP_0 OP_PUSHBYTES_20 18b5bf5f768ed224d07d303df8343a40b4326943
- address
- bc1qrz6m7hmk3mfzf5raxq7lsdp6gz6ry62rdxq47d